As an Assistant Building Maintenance Manager, your main responsibilities will include:
- Leading by example and serving as a role model for the standards and behaviors that align with Bozzuto's core values and culture.
- Demonstrating care and concern for our residents by ensuring timely follow-ups and meticulous completion of apartment service tickets.
- Addressing maintenance issues across HVAC, electrical, plumbing, and appliance repairs.
- Overseeing the make-ready and apartment turnover process with a focus on detail and timeliness to facilitate leasing and the move-in of new residents.
- Safeguarding the building's value by consistently implementing preventative maintenance programs.
- Maintaining the building's aesthetic and ensuring community safety through general upkeep, cleanliness, snow removal, and grounds maintenance.
- Ensuring peak operational efficiency for all property components.
- Complying with relevant building, county, and safety codes/standards while maintaining an accident-free operation.
- Participating in weekend work and the emergency on-call rotation.
